Alchemist (Paulo Coelho) - What can I say? Its never to late to read a good book and so I was not late to read a good book. A bible in its own way

Adultery (Paulo Coelho) - Learn to Love :) With all the dogma set down author defines Love in a more realistic sense. Loved it!

Forbidden Desires (Madhuri Banerjee) - I simply love Madhuri Banerjee. I find her candid. Desires are often forbidden in this land of diversity and how different characters dealt with it made me smile. I shared this book with 3 of my friends


Naw Hanyate (Maitreyi Devi) - Some books are legendary. So is "Naw Hanyate" (meaning It Does Not Die) written by Maitreyi Devi. Hum Dil De Chuke Sanam the movie is based on this book.

Love is eternal and that is exactly what the book says


Like the Flowing River (Paulo Coelho) - U dont want to read a lot at one go but you want to finish the story. This is the book for you. Short write ups that are inspirational in their own way. Brings in different colors of life :)
